Abstract
This is a brief review of vacuum string field theory, a new approach to open string field theory based on the stable vacuum of the tachyon. We discuss the sliver state explaining its role as a projector in the space of half-string functionals. We review the construction of D-brane solutions in vacuum string field theory, both in the algebraic approach and in the more general geometrical approach that emphasizes the role of boundary CFT. -- To appear in the Proceedings of Strings 2001, Mumbai, India.
